Components of Your Mortgage Payment

When calculating your mortgage payment, consider these four key components, often referred to as PITI:

  • Principal (P): The portion of your payment that reduces the original loan amount.
  • Interest (I): The cost of borrowing the principal, based on your loan’s interest rate.
  • Taxes (T): Property taxes, which vary by location. In White Deer, Texas, property tax rates average around 1.8% of home value, according to the Texas Comptroller of Public Accounts.
  • Insurance (I): Homeowners insurance and, if applicable, private mortgage insurance (PMI) for loans with less than 20% down payment.

Expected Costs for White Deer Residents

For example, if you secure a 30-year loan for $180,000. A common home price in White Deer. With a 4.5% interest rate, your monthly principal and interest payment would be approximately $912. Add in property taxes (about $270/month based on Texas averages), homeowners insurance (around $100/month), and possibly PMI, and your total monthly payment could rise to $1,300 or more. Home Buying in White Deer, Texas

White Deer, located in Carson County in the Texas Panhandle, is a hidden gem for home buyers seeking affordability and a quiet, rural lifestyle. With a population of just over 900 as per the U.S. Census Bureau (2020 data), this small town offers a tight-knit community feel, low crime rates, and a slower pace of life compared to bustling urban centers. According to Zillow, the median home price in White Deer as of 2023 hovers around $160,000. Well below the Texas state average of $340,000 reported by the Texas Real Estate Research Center. This affordability makes it an attractive option for first-time buyers, retirees, and families looking to stretch their budgets.

The town’s proximity to Amarillo, about 40 miles away, provides access to larger job markets, healthcare, and entertainment while maintaining the charm of small-town living. White Deer also benefits from the absence of state income tax in Texas, which can leave more money in your pocket for mortgage payments or home improvements. Local schools, part of the White Deer Independent School District, are well-regarded, making it a family-friendly location.

Understanding Mortgage Factors in White Deer, Texas

Mortgage costs and requirements can vary based on location. In White Deer:

  • Property Taxes: Texas has some of the highest property taxes in the U.S., averaging 1.8% of home value per year, per the Tax Foundation. For a $160,000 home in White Deer, that’s about $2,880 annually or $240 monthly.
  • Home Prices: Affordable compared to state averages, but limited inventory in small towns like White Deer may require quick decisions.
  • No State Income Tax: This Texas perk can offset high property taxes, leaving more for mortgage payments or savings.
  • Rural Considerations: Fewer local lenders mean working with a knowledgeable broker like Summit Lending is crucial for navigating loan options.
